Knee surgery performed on 34 patients



KATHMANDU: The Jorpati-based Nepal Orthopedic Hospital has performed knee surgery on 34 patients.

A team of specialist doctors supported by the Operation Walk Chicago in the United States (US) performed surgeries on 43 knees of 34 patients in five days.

Senior administrative officer of the hospital, Dhiraj Mainali said that the surgery was carried out on the patients who had long been suffering from knee pain.

Medical Director of the hospital, Dr Kailash Kumar Bhandari said the hospital was providing more easy and accessible services to the citizens.

Orthopedic surgeon Dr Rabi Basyal, who came from the US, said that the hospital has been collaborating with the orthopedic hospital since 2009 and so far about 600 knee surgeries have been performed.

Established in 1998 as a non-profit organization dedicated to the health care of orphans, helpless, and disabled citizens, the hospital has been providing services to orthopedic patients.
